Echo Hill Outdoor School is seeking a dedicated and organized Program Director to lead the scheduling, planning, and execution of our educational programs. The Program Director will be responsible for ensuring a seamless experience for visiting schools and groups, customizing curricula to fit client needs, managing the program staff, helping oversee daily operations, and maintaining high standards of program quality. This role is ideal for an individual passionate about outdoor education, environmental stewardship, and fostering participant engagement with nature.
Summary
Key Responsibilities
- Coordinate with schools and groups to schedule educational visits, maintaining a master schedule of all programs to ensure each school/group’s needs are met.
- Collaborate with school coordinators to tailor curricula that align with each group’s educational goals.
- Recruit, train, and supervise program staff, including educators and interns.
- Foster a positive, team-oriented culture and provide ongoing support and professional development for staff.
- Oversee day-to-day operations of all programs, ensuring safety, quality, and smooth logistics, with daily check-ins with program staff and visiting faculty/chaperones.
- Manage daily program schedule
- Monitor and evaluate the effectiveness of programs, making adjustments as needed to maintain high standards.
Qualifications
- Bachelor’s degree in Education, Environmental Studies, Outdoor Education, Leadership or a related field.
- Master’s degree and/or teacher certification preferred.
- Minimum of 3 years of experience in program management, preferably in an outdoor or educational setting.
- Proven ability to work effectively with schools, educational administrators, and group organizers.
- Strong leadership, communication, and organizational skills.
- Knowledge of outdoor safety standards and best practices.
Passionate about environmental education and working with young people.
